The ingredients needed to make Chicken Soba Noodles for Cold Days:
  1. Prepare Other ingredients
  2. Make ready 1/4 Chicken thighs
  3. Get 1 Green onions
  4. Take Noodles
  5. Prepare 1 serving Soba (dried, fresh, etc)
  6. Take Soba mentsuyu
  7. Make ready 300 ml ☆Water
  8. Make ready 1/2 tsp ☆Dashi stock granules
  9. Make ready 2/3 tbsp ☆Soy sauce
  10. Prepare 1 tbsp ☆Mirin
  11. Get 1 pinch ☆Sugar

Steps to make Chicken Soba Noodles for Cold Days:
  1. Cut the chicken into bite sized pieces, rinse in boiling water, and drain in a strainer.
  2. Add all of the ☆ ingredients to a pot and bring to a boil for the mentsuyu.
  3. Add the chicken to the pot from Step 2 and bring to a boil. Remove any scum as soon as it forms.
  4. Boil the soba to your desired firmness and drain in a strainer.
  5. Transfer the noodles and the mentsuyu in a dish and it's complete. Top with minced green onions if you like.
